Meadhbh Chambers provides an avenue for adults to approach crucially important conversation with young people about sharing their thoughts, feelings and worries. This book will lead children to naturally refer to themselves and compare themselves to Rosie and equip them with the tools they need to be able to ask for help when needed.

  Meadhbh Chambers is a primary school teacher who is passionate about developing emotional literacy in young children. As a mother of four Meadhbh values story time and sees the benefit in having a resource like a book to provoke thought and open up conversation.
